Taft Musicians at Forman School’s Production of Into the Woods

The Taft School musicians volunteered to play the score for the Forman School Ensemble Players' production.

Instrumental Music Teacher T.J. Thompson and his students recently volunteered their time and talents as the pit orchestra for the Forman School’s production of Into the Woods.

Music for the show was written by Stephen Sondheim; vocals were performed by the Forman Ensemble Players.

The Forman Ensemble Players presented the winter musical “Into the Woods” this week. Ms. Halloran P’05, P’07, Director of Counseling, described the musical as “an enchanting and fun performance.”
